Cilain

The Festivals of the Changing Seasons, Cilain is an ancient celebration, practiced by the peoples of the northern borders of the Allfire Peaks. It is a tradition of duality, and holds great significance in across the north.

Execution

Cilain is actually two seperate holidays, each respectively connected to the ends of summer and winter. They tie into the land and how the gods perceive the inhabitants, and thus many take this celebration very seriously. While they are under the same name, the two holidays are executed very differently.   During the end of summer, citizens collect some of the best of their crops and livestock, and bring them to a designated spot to be sacrificed. Animals have their more succulent parts burned (such as the fat and tenderloin) and keep the rest for themselves to eat during the cold months. This is done as an offering to the gods, in the hopes that they will make the winter less easier on them.   The second Cilain is a much more cheerful event, a celebration of the end of winter and beginning of spring. During this event, prepare themselves various costumes and masks, usually meant to represent some sort of animal, and spread flowers around their town and fields, to drive of an mock dark spirits and færies. When twilight falls, the day is nothing but dancing, drinking, and other joyous shenanigans and good times.

Components and tools

Regardless of which event, very little components are needed. For the winter sacrifice, a priest requires a knife, for the livestock that will be offered, and a fire pit, to burn the offerings and send them to the gods. The sprin celebration only truly requires a costume and a wooden mask, both of which are easy to make. The “costumes” are in actuality just furs and skins wrapped or tied around themselves. A few remote locations use Oracledust to further release their in inhabitions, insuring that are their cares are truly forgotten on the night.

Observance

The holiday of Cilain is known and celebrated all around the lands north of the Allfire Peaks and some have brought it to the regions south of ths mountians as well. They correspond to the ends of winter and summer, either as soon as the environment begins to change (leaves change colors, snow begins melting, etc.) or during the respective summer and winter solstices.
